On Wed, 2005-12-21 at 16:07 -0500, Chris Ryland wrote: > Digging around, reading lots of books on it, I'm still getting > conflicting stories on Subversion repository backup. > > If we're using the FSFS respository, doing system image backups late > at night when no check-ins are in progress, do I really need to do > some kind of special repository backup?
Well, trying to count on the fact that people probably aren't working at that time of night is not a good policy. However with FSFS backing up the files naively is safe even if there's a commit in progress.
